Corporate Giving & Sponsorship
Taking a stand for future generations.
As part of our ongoing commitment to conservation and preservation, BioStorage Technologies supports international, as well as local, nature and wildlife organizations. Our support also extends to organizations that impact the communities we live and work in.
We currently support the following organizations and their initiatives:
- World Wildlife Fund—Our latest project is the polar bear adoption program through the World Wildlife Fund. With global warming, the polar bear’s habitat is shrinking, thereby threatening its hunting and very survival. We have begun giving the gift of polar bear adoption prizes at our various trade shows around the world.

- Nature Conservancy—We financially support this leading conservation organization that works around the world. Its mission is to preserve the plants, animals and natural communities that represent the diversity of life on Earth by protecting the lands and waters they need to survive.

- The Indianapolis Zoo—We are inspired by this leader in the movement to transform zoos from places to simply view animals, into institutions dedicated to conservation and education. The Zoo inspires local and global communities to celebrate, protect and preserve the natural world, while providing an enriching and wondrous environment to the animals in their care.

- Asian American Alliance—With a mission to inspire Central Indiana Asian Americans to serve and lead within the community, this not-for-profit organization advocates the importance of diversity and inclusion.

- Indy Partnership—This organization helps bring new economic opportunities to the Indianapolis region. Since 2001, the Indy Partnership has worked with local partners to attract or retain more than 60,000 jobs and has sparked more than $6 billion in new capital investment in the region.

- Veterans of Valor/Freedom Group of America—This non-profit organization serves U.S. combat-wounded veterans. Through providing specific items, services and programs, Veterans of Valor provides tangible support to severely wounded heroes and their families.
